Mynämäki Parish is seeking an operational plan/possible business model for the old rectory (parish office) being sold through a closed auction procedure
An approx. 4,500 m² plot will be separated from the property.
A new owner for the property for sale will be sought via a closed auction procedure. In the procedure’s first stage the bidder must submit a participation notice together with an operational plan (one offer to this auction and a separate written participation notice with the operational plan sent by the deadline by e‑mail). Based on these, selected participants will be invited separately to the closed auction (to determine the price for the property).
Stage 1: participation notice (submitting one offer to this announcement and a separate written participation notice with an operational plan by the deadline). This is not the purchase offer for the property, but entitles the bidder to take part in stage 2 of the competition.
Stage 2: a bid price will be submitted as the offered purchase price for the property (a separate auction for invited participants only).
Mynämäki Parish requires that participation in this first stage secures the right to participate in the second stage.
Separate written participation notice
The participation notice must present a plan for the proposed use of the property and a possible business model including financing options. Please also provide contact details / name, telephone number and e‑mail address. Failure to deliver the participation notice by the deadline will result in rejection from the competition and will not permit participation in stage 2.

Property details: The current main building of the Mynämäki rectory was built in the 1860s. The rectory is located by the Mynäjoki river in one of the municipality’s most picturesque locations. The building is currently used by the parish as the parish office and financial office and contains staff workspaces. The rectory has previously been used as a residence. Heating is via district heating. Consumption in 2025 was 50.934 MWh. The sauna building is in a condition suitable for demolition. More detailed information can be found in the attachments.

Inspection of the property
The bidder is obliged to inspect the property, documents and records before making an offer. The buyer may not later claim a matter that could have been observed during the preliminary inspection.
Information provided by the seller
The seller warrants that they have provided the buyer with all information known to the seller that can be assumed to affect the transaction.
Conclusion of the sale
The sale of the property must be made in the form required by the Land Code. The time and place for signing the deed of sale will be agreed with the buyer separately. Payment of the purchase price takes place at the signing. The fee of the transaction confirmer is paid half by the seller and half by the buyer.
Other costs
The buyer is responsible for the transfer tax in accordance with the applicable tax practice.
Withdrawal from the sale
A party who refuses to complete the sale must, under the Land Code, compensate the other party for reasonable costs incurred for advertisement, inspection of the property and other necessary actions related to concluding the sale.
